Description
A three-dimensional parametric model was developed for the systematic migration of multiple sandbars on the Chirihama and Takamatsu Coast, Ishikawa, Japan. First, the principal modes of bar migration were extracted by an EOF analysis for the annual surveys over 11 years, and were approximated by a combimnation of simple functions for each survey line. Next, the alongshore variation of parameters in phase and amplitude variations were modeled by regression analysis. A three-dimensional parametric model was then established by synthesis of the approximate functions governing the cross-shore and alongshore variations. The comparison with field measurement demonstrated that the model is able to reproduce the main characteristics of the three-dimensional configuration and the spatio-temporal transition of the multiple sandbar systems. An ergodic feature is observed between the temporal and alongshore variation in mulitiple bar configuration.
